Growth of Plant-Based Food Products
The The food flavors market is significantly impacted by the increasing popularity of plant-based food products. is significantly impacted by the increasing popularity of plant-based food products. As more consumers adopt vegetarian and vegan diets, the demand for flavors that complement these products is on the rise. Recent statistics suggest that the plant-based food sector in France has grown by over 20% in the past year, prompting flavor manufacturers to innovate and create new taste profiles that cater to this demographic. This growth is not only driven by health considerations but also by environmental concerns, as consumers seek sustainable alternatives to traditional animal-based products. Consequently, the food flavors market is likely to expand as companies invest in developing flavors that enhance the sensory experience of plant-based offerings.

Rising Demand for Clean Label Products
The The food flavors market is experiencing a notable shift towards clean label products. is experiencing a notable shift towards clean label products, driven by consumer preferences for transparency and natural ingredients. This trend indicates that consumers are increasingly scrutinizing food labels, seeking products that are free from artificial additives and preservatives. According to recent data, approximately 60% of French consumers express a preference for clean label options, which is influencing manufacturers to reformulate their offerings. This demand for authenticity and simplicity is reshaping the food flavors market, as companies strive to align their products with consumer expectations. As a result, the industry is likely to see a surge in the development of flavors derived from natural sources, thereby enhancing the appeal of food products in a competitive marketplace.
